Tom Robinson lives on the outskirts of Maycomb with his wife and three children. He's very kind, helpful, earns a lot of respect by the people in Maycomb by what he does for everyone and attends church regularly with Calpurnia. He works on a cotton field for Link Deas. One day as he was working the Cotton gin, his left arm got stuck in the machine. It paralyzed his arm and made it twelve inches shorter then his right arm. Tom Robinson got accused of raping Mayella Ewell when he was doing a chore for her. The jury came up with the verdict of him being gulity for raping Mayella Ewell. Tom was then moved to a jail 70 miles outside of Maycomb. He tried to escape but a guard caught him and shot him 17 times which killed him. When Mr. Underwood heard about Tom's death he saw it as Tom was an innocent person who didn't deserve to be killed over something he didn't do just becasue of his race. Tom is also considered a mockingbird in the story. Tom was found gulity when it was pretty obvious that he wasn't and he attempted to get out of the jail to have freedom but was killed.
